John 16:33
“I have told you these things, so that in me you may have peace. In this world you will have trouble. But take heart! I have overcome the world.”


2 Peter 2:20
If they have escaped the corruption of the world by knowing our Lord and Savior Jesus Christ and are again entangled in it and are overcome, they are worse off at the end than they were at the beginning.


1 John 4:4
You, dear children, are from God and have overcome them, because the one who is in you is greater than the one who is in the world.


1 John 5:4
for everyone born of God overcomes the world. This is the victory that has overcome the world, even our faith.

1 John 5:5
Who is it that overcomes the world? Only the one who believes that Jesus is the Son of God.

No, that's not what she or I have said. It's a pity that you don't understand what you say you read in the Scriptures. The Bible says that first we must HAVE FAITH IN JESUS AND HIS RANSOM SACRIFICE IN OUR BEHALF. That comes first.

Then we must show our faith by our works, and follow Jesus' teachings. We cannot "earn" our salvation. Jesus died for us and without his sacrifice we would be lost. We must, however, work in accordance with his life example and his teachings.

1) "For God so loved the world that He gave His only begotten Son that whosoever believeth in him should not perish, but have everlasting life." (John 3:16)

2) "I will show thee my faith by my works....The devils also believe and tremble....Faith without works is dead." (James 2:18b-20)

3) "Christ also suffered for us, leaving us an example, that ye should follow his steps." (I Peter 2:21)
